Disability shower installation services involve designing and fitting showers that acc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or physical disabilities. These installations often feature accessible elements such as low or no-threshold entryways, grab bars, seating options, and non-slip surfaces. The goal is to create a safe, functional, and comfortable bathing environment that meets specific needs, whether for permanent accessibility or temporary adjustments. Professional installers work to ensure that the shower setup adheres to ergonomic principles and safety standards, helping to improve independence and reduce the risk of accidents during bathing routines.
Such services address common problems faced by individuals with limited mobility, including difficulty entering traditional showers, the risk of slips and falls, and the lack of supportive features. Traditional showers may not be suitable or safe for those with disabilities, leading to potential injuries or reliance on caregivers. Disability shower installation helps mitigate these issues by providing accessible features that facilitate easier, safer use. This can be particularly beneficial for seniors, people recovering from injury or surgery, or those with chronic conditions affecting mobility.

The overview below groups typical Disability Shower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Middlesex County,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Installation Costs - The cost for installing a disability shower typically ranges from $1,500 to $4,500, depending on the complexity and materials used. Basic models may be on the lower end, while custom features can increase the price.
Material Expenses - The price of materials for disability showers can vary between $300 and $1,200, with options like durable acrylic or tiled surrounds influencing costs. Higher-end materials tend to be more expensive.
Labor Charges - Labor costs for professional installation generally fall between $500 and $2,000, depending on the scope of work and local service providers in Middlesex County, MA. Additional plumbing or electrical work may increase these costs.
Additional Features - Installing features such as grab bars, seats, or non-slip flooring can add $200 to $800 to the overall cost. These upgrades improve safety and accessibility but vary based on the selected options.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
